Model: MC120B (Fixed )
Hook Height:44 m
Jib Length: 60m
Mast Section:1.6m×1.6m×3 m
Max. Load:6t
Load at Jib End:1.15t
Hoisting Winch:33PC15/40LVF15
Slewing Mechanism:RCV145
Trolley Winch:4D3V3
Nominal Power:45KVA 400V(+10%-10%)  50HZ

Q:I just made origami cranes and want to hang them up, each by themselves with just a peice of string....how should i go about doing this? how is it usually done?
TAke a needle threaded with a long piece of black thread, and make a small knot at end of long thread. Push the needle thru the middle of the crane's back and pull the thread all the way thru the hole till the knot catches. pull the needle off the loose end of the thread and make another knot on that end. take a push pin or thumb tack and push the pin thru the knot, then push the pin or tack into the ceiling. FYI, tape never works - I have tried. The black thread lets them flutter a bit, and is invisible most of the time. p.s. ask your parents if you can hang stuff from the ceiling first. they may not want you to do that since it will leave holes in the ceiling when you take them down.
Q:I just wonder they use cranes at such heights, how do they carry the cranes at such height? Helicopter or something? This is a picture of what I'm talking
The cranes are jack-up cranes. They have their own self-contained jacks. As one floor is completed, they jack up to the next level. The cranes are on top of the buildings. They are designed by structural and mechanical engineers to loift a given weight.
Q:What is the load moment of a crane?
The load moment for a crane is a number measuring the weight of the load lifted times the distance between the mass and the centre of the crane's superstructure. For example, a 20 ton weight lifted at 5m away from the crane (in reality, right next to it!) gives us a load moment of 100 ton*m, the same as a 10 ton weight lifted 10m from the crane. Cranes can handle higher load moments closer to the crane, so really heavy lifts are always done from very close to the load.
